Closest Climatic Station

Carnegie
Distance from Banjo Creek, Wongawol Rd 138.92km NE
 JanFebMarAprMayJun JulAugSepOctNovDec
Mean Max. °C 38.336.833.829.8 25.221.121.123.6 28.632.535.437.2
Mean Min. °C 23.322.820.016.1 10.97.05.77.3 11.816.219.322.1
Mean Rain mm 28.853.132.722.1 16.715.012.57.6 3.54.811.023.8

 Treks passing Banjo Creek, Wongawol Rd

Gunbarrel Highway Gunbarrel Highway
The Gunbarrel Hwy is one of Australia's most famous roads being the first of many desert tracks built by surveyor Len Beadell. Today, this track remains isolated and remote - for experienced desert travellers only. [Feature Story]
